With the months of the year, in Italian, the preposition a is the most commonly used, even if in can also be correct in some cases. If you want to make things easier, though, using a is the best solution! Mio figlio è nato a luglio. My son was born in July. Il giorno di Natale è a/in dicembre.

Follow these 5 tips to say the Italian months like a local: 1. Pay attention to double letters. In Italian, double letters like the NN in gennaio, should be nice and long. It helps to almost pause a little in the middle when you say them: gen-naio. feb-braio. mag-gio. set-tembre.

Oggi è (today is) number + month. For example, oggi è il 27 marzo (today is March 27). There are two important things to note: First, the date always comes before the month in Italian. Second, you don't capitalize the months in Italian. For the first day of the month, you use the ordinal number for one: primo.

The Italian Months of the Year. Now let's move on to the months of the year in Italian. Unlike the days of the week, the months bear a very close resemblance to their English counterparts. Gennaio (January) From the Latin Januarius (mensis) meaning '(month) of Janus'. Janus is the Roman god who presided over doors and beginnings.

Italian Months of the Year / Mesi dell'anno. Days and months are not capitalized. To express the date, use È il (number) (month). May 5th would be È il 5 (or cinque) maggio. But for the first of the month, use primo instead of 1 or uno. To express ago, as in two days ago, a month ago, etc., just add fa afterwards.
